NY D82330 September 19, 1998 CLA-2-87:RR:NC:MM:101 D82330 CATEGORY: Classification TARIFF NO.: 8708.29.5010 Mr. Robert J. Resetar Customs Manager Porsche Cars North America, Inc. 980 Hammond Drive Suite 1000 Atlanta, GA 30328 RE: The tariff classification of Windshield Molding from Germany Dear Mr. Resetar: In your letter dated September 7, 1998, you requested a tariff classification ruling. The part in question is a Windshield Molding which is a curved, stamped piece of chrome plated aluminum measuring approximately 35" x 1" x 1/8" (l x w x h). You submitted a picture of the part from your parts microfiche system. The applicable subheading for the Windshield Molding will be 8708.29.5010,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S), which provides for Parts and accessories of the motor vehicles of headings 8701 to 8705: Other parts and accessories of bodies: Other: Other...body stampings. The rate of duty will be 2.6% ad valorem. This ruling is being issued under the provisions of Part 177 of the Customs Regulations (19 C.F.R. 177). A copy of the ruling or the control number indicated above should be provided with the entry documents filed at the time this merchandise is imported.
